How to Make Smash Chicken Caesar Tacos
Preparing the Chicken
Start by preheating your grill or skillet over medium-high heat. Season those chicken breasts with salt and pepper—don’t be shy! Grill them for about 6-7 minutes on each side until they reach an internal temperature of 165°F and are beautifully charred.
Shredding the Chicken
Once grilled, let the chicken rest for about five minutes. This allows the juices to redistribute, making every bite juicy and tender. Then comes the fun part: shred the chicken using two forks until it resembles fluffy clouds of deliciousness.
Mixing in Flavor
In a mixing bowl, combine your shredded chicken, minced garlic (the more, the merrier), and half of your creamy Caesar dressing. Toss until every piece of chicken is coated in that heavenly sauce; this step infuses flavor into every nook and cranny.
Assembling Your Tacos
Warm those corn tortillas in a dry skillet for about thirty seconds on each side until they’re pliable but still sturdy. Now it’s time to assemble! Place a generous spoonful of that irresistible chicken mixture onto each tortilla followed by freshly chopped romaine lettuce.
Finishing Touches
Drizzle with additional Caesar dressing if you dare—who could resist? Top off with grated parmesan cheese for that extra zing! Serve immediately while everything is still warm, so your guests can dive right in.

Storing & Reheating
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, warm the chicken in a skillet over low heat and enjoy fresh toppings!

Ingredients
- 3 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1.5 lbs)
- 3 cloves fresh garlic, minced
- 4 cups chopped romaine lettuce
- 1/2 cup Caesar dressing
- 8 small corn tortillas
- 1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ese
Instructions
- Preheat grill or skillet to medium-high heat.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per. Grill for 6-7 minutes per side until cooked through (165°F internal temperature). Let rest.
- Shred the chicken using two forks until fluffy.
- In a mixing bowl, combine shredded chicken, minced garlic, and half of the Caesar dressing; mix well.
- Warm corn tortillas in a dry skillet for about 30 seconds on each side.
- Assemble tacos by placing a spoonful of chicken mixture on each tortilla, followed by chopped romaine and additional Caesar dressing if desired. Top with grated parmesan cheese.
- Serve immediately and enjoy!
